    Thought the above study would be an item of "gee whiz" historical interest. They attached explosive-filled sections of pipe to the sides of Sherman tanks in an effort to create a close-range antipersonnel defensive device.

    Looks like it was unsuccessful. Too hard on the armor. Presumably there would be no friendly infantry in the immediate vicinity when the need to use this arose.
